Senator Adams Visits Darchai Menachem

CROWN HEIGHTS, Brooklyn [CHI] – This past Friday New York State Senator Eric Adams (D, Brooklyn) visited Crown Heights’s Yeshivas Darchai Menachem. Mr. Adams first met with the school’s principal Rabbi Eyal Bension who explained to him what makes Darchai Menachem such a unique school.

Mr. Adams then spoke to the students in the schools Shul, yet instead of lecturing he had the students tell him what they like best about school and was interested in hearing what student’s hobbies were. Some answered that they like math most others said it was Gemara but recess was not left out. Mr. Adams went on to say that it is though education that we can combat anti-Semitism and racism, commenting on the recent hate crimes in the community.

Afterwards the students posed for a picture together with the Senator following which they shook his hand. On his way out he said he had a few other stops to still make on the rainy Friday in a number of other schools in Crown Heights.
